Is it OK to Put a Memory Foam Mattress on a Box Spring?
Putting a memory foam mattress on a box spring is generally okay, but there are a few things to keep in mind. First, make sure the box spring is in good condition. If it's old or damaged, it may not provide the proper support for your new mattress. Additionally, make sure the box spring is the right size for your mattress. A mismatched size could cause the mattress to shift or sag, leading to discomfort and potential damage.
Do You Need a Box Spring with a Memory Foam Mattress?
While a box spring is not necessary for a memory foam mattress, it can provide some benefits. A box spring can add additional support and help distribute weight evenly, which can extend the lifespan of your mattress. It can also raise the height of your bed, making it easier to get in and out of. However, if you prefer a lower bed or have a platform bed with built-in support, a box spring may not be necessary.
Can You Use a Box Spring with a Memory Foam Mattress?
If you do decide to use a box spring with your memory foam mattress, there are some steps you should take to ensure it is properly set up. First, make sure the box spring is the same size as your mattress. Next, check the weight limit of your box spring. Memory foam mattresses can be quite heavy, so you want to make sure your box spring can support it without bowing or breaking. It's also a good idea to use a non-slip mat between the box spring and mattress to keep it in place.

Can You Put a Memory Foam Mattress on a Box Spring Without a Frame?
While it's not recommended, you can technically put a memory foam mattress on a box spring without a frame. However, it's important to note that this is not the most stable or supportive setup and could potentially damage your mattress. A bed frame is important for providing proper support and stability for your mattress, so it's best to use one if possible.
